Your money or your gas. No wait. Your money or your car.

I know they're saying that high gas prices are leading to more gas theft on the part of criminals, but how about someone taking a whole car and holding it for ransom?

Speaking of gas theft, a special meanie award should go to the people who took gas from trucks opearated by the Second Harvest Food Bank of Santa Clara County. Locking gas caps will deter some theives, but now I'm hearing that some of the theives are simply cutting the fuel lines or punching holes in the tanks from beneath. And Many of the hapless desperados end up losing more gas than they gain when they turn out to be less than adept at siphoning.
